Forgotten hotspots: Areas close to waste-to-energy plants have Delhi’s worst air; Okhla, Ghazipur worst hit | Delhi News

NEW DELHI: Residents living around the capital’s waste-to-energy (WTE) plants at Okhla, Narela-Bawana, Ghazipur and Tehkhand are among the worst hit by pollution as Delhi gasps under a shroud of very poor air.People in these neighbourhoods say the air is foul all year, and the situation is unbearable in winter, especially when the plants, burning…
